What makes an authentic Kruger souvenir?

Apply a simple three-part test to any potential purchase before browsing for safari souvenir ideas:

  • Origin — Was it made in South Africa, ideally by Lowveld or Mpumalanga artisans?
  • Material — Does it use locally sourced, legally obtained, or sustainable materials?
  • Impact — Does the purchase benefit a local maker, cooperative, or conservation fund?

If a product passes all three, it qualifies as a genuine African safari gift worth taking home.

The best African safari gifts by category

1. Hand-carved wooden sculptures

Woodcarving is one of Southern Africa’s oldest craft traditions and among the most sought-after unique African gifts for good reason. Pieces depicting the Big 5 (lion, leopard, elephant, rhino, and buffalo) are carved from indigenous woods including tamboti and marula.

Look for pieces with visible tool marks and natural grain variation. These signal hand-craftsmanship rather than machine production. Reputable vendors will confirm the wood species and its legal sourcing.

Sizes range from pocket-friendly figurines to statement pieces for a mantelpiece. A carved elephant family, for instance, travels well and carries immediate visual impact.

2. Beaded jewellery and Ndebele craft

The Ndebele people of South Africa are internationally recognised for their geometric beadwork. Bracelets, necklaces, and decorative panels use vivid colour combinations that carry deep cultural symbolism, making them among the most meaningful safari keepsakes.

Beaded jewellery is lightweight, easy to pack, and deeply personal. It also makes an excellent gift for someone who did not make the trip, offering them a wearable piece of South African heritage.

Ask whether the item was made by an individual artisan or a women’s cooperative when purchasing. Cooperatives near the Kruger region often channel proceeds into education and healthcare for their members.

3. Bush-inspired fragrances and skincare

The Lowveld bush has a distinctive scent: dry grass, marula blossom, and warm earth after rain. Several South African brands have translated this into perfumes, body oils, and skincare ranges, offering some of the most evocative safari gifts ideas on the market.

Marula oil, cold-pressed from the fruit of the marula tree (Sclerocarya birrea), is a globally recognised skincare ingredient native to Southern Africa. Products featuring certified marula oil make practical, luxurious gifts that connect the recipient directly to the landscape.

Look for brands that source ingredients from community-owned trees and carry fair-trade or organic certification.

4. Wildlife photography prints and textile art

South Africa has produced world-class wildlife photographers, many of whom work exclusively in and around Kruger. Limited-edition prints, signed and numbered, are among the most lasting African safari gifts available.

Textile alternatives include hand-printed fabric panels and batik work featuring Kruger wildlife motifs. These are produced by artists across Mpumalanga and make striking wall pieces without the fragility of framed photography. Look closely at provenance and artist credentials in this category, it’s where unique African gifts carry the most lasting value.

Both formats ship internationally through reputable galleries and can be rolled into a protective tube for travel.

5. Ethical leather and hide goods

Leather goods crafted from ethically sourced South African hides (ostrich, kudu, or cattle) are durable, distinctive, and practical. Wallets, journal covers, and camera bags are popular safari souvenir ideas for travellers who prefer functional keepsakes.

Crucially, avoid any product made from protected species. Reputable retailers carry documentation confirming legal sourcing. Walk away if a vendor cannot provide provenance information.

The Kruger region has several established leather workshops producing goods that meet both South African law and international import requirements.

6. Rooibos, honeybush, and safari food gifts

South Africa’s indigenous teas, rooibos and honeybush, are recognised globally for their antioxidant properties and caffeine-free profiles (Source: South African Rooibos Council, 2023). Both grow wild in the Western Cape and are widely available in premium gift sets, making them effortless African safari gifts for those who appreciate flavour over fuss.

Pair with bush-spice blends for a food hamper that delivers an authentic taste of South Africa. These travel well in sealed packaging and clear customs in most countries when declared correctly.

How to shop responsibly: A step-by-step guide

Following these steps ensures your African safari gifts are authentic, ethical, and legally exportable.

Step 1: Research before you arrive

Identify the safari souvenir ideas that interest you: craft, food, fragrance, or art. Knowing what you want prevents impulse purchases of low-quality imports.

Step 2: Buy directly from artisans or verified cooperatives

Markets near the Kruger region, including those in Hazyview and White River in Mpumalanga, host verified local makers. Direct purchases maximise the benefit to the craftsperson.

Step 3: Ask about materials and sourcing

Ask the vendor to confirm the species and legal origin for wood, leather, and wildlife-related products. Reputable sellers expect and welcome this question.

Step 4: Check export regulations for your destination country

Some organic materials, animal products, and plant-based goods require permits or may be restricted at your destination. Check with your country’s customs authority before purchasing.

Step 5: Keep receipts and certificates of authenticity

Retain all documentation for high-value art or leather goods. This protects you at customs and confirms the item’s provenance for insurance purposes.

Step 6: Pack with care

Wooden and ceramic pieces should be wrapped in clothing rather than bubble wrap where possible, it minimises plastic waste and uses luggage space efficiently.

Frequently asked questions

What are the most popular African safari gifts to bring home from Kruger?

Hand-carved wooden sculptures, Ndebele beaded jewellery, marula-based skincare, wildlife photography prints, and rooibos tea gift sets are consistently among the most sought-after Kruger safari souvenirs. All are available from artisans and verified vendors near the park.

Are animal products like leather and ivory legal to bring home from South Africa?

Ethically sourced leather from non-protected species (such as ostrich or cattle) is generally legal with proper documentation. Ivory is banned under CITES regulations and must never be purchased. Always request provenance certificates and check your home country’s import rules before buying.

Where can I buy authentic Kruger souvenirs near the park?

Markets in Hazyview and White River (Mpumalanga), as well as curated gift options at lodges like Kruger Gate Hotel, are reliable sources. Buying directly from artisans or registered cooperatives ensures authenticity and maximises community benefit.

Is Kruger National Park worth visiting year-round for a safari and shopping experience?

Yes. Kruger and the surrounding Lowveld region offer a rewarding experience in every season. Wildlife is present throughout the year, and local craft markets operate year-round, making any time an ideal opportunity to discover unique African gifts and authentic safari souvenir ideas.

How do I pack wooden carvings and fragile souvenirs safely for the flight home?

Wrap wooden pieces in soft clothing items to cushion them and save on plastic waste. Place heavier items at the base of your bag. Consider posting them home via a registered courier service for framed prints or ceramics, many galleries near Kruger offer this option.
